Where to Find Authentic Darts Memorabilia

Finding genuine BDO PDC Memorabilia requires careful research and a degree of caution. The market is unfortunately rife with fakes and forgeries, so it’s essential to buy from reputable sources.

  • Official PDC Website and Merchandise Stores: This is the safest place to buy officially licensed memorabilia, guaranteeing authenticity.
  • Reputable Memorabilia Dealers: Look for established dealers with a proven track record and positive customer reviews. Check if they offer certificates of authenticity.
  • Auction Houses: Well-known auction houses often sell darts memorabilia, but always do your research and verify the provenance of items before bidding.
  • Online Marketplaces (with Caution): Sites like eBay can be a source of deals, but exercise extreme caution. Check the seller’s feedback, ask detailed questions, and look for certificates of authenticity. Be wary of items priced significantly below market value.

Verifying Authenticity: Tips for Spotting Fakes

Protecting yourself from fake BDO PDC Memorabilia requires due diligence and a critical eye. Here are some key tips to help you spot forgeries:

  • Examine the Signature: Compare the signature to known authentic examples. Look for inconsistencies in the flow, pressure, and style of the signature.
  • Check the Provenance: Ask for detailed information about the item’s history, including where it came from and who owned it previously. A solid provenance is a strong indicator of authenticity.
  • Request a Certificate of Authenticity (COA): A COA from a reputable authenticator can provide peace of mind, but be aware that some COAs are themselves fake. Research the issuing company before relying on their certification.
  • Inspect the Item’s Condition: Look for signs of wear and tear that are inconsistent with the item’s claimed age or use.
  • Trust Your Gut: If something feels off about an item, it’s best to err on the side of caution and walk away.

The Value of Darts Memorabilia: What Drives Prices?

The value of BDO PDC Memorabilia is influenced by several factors, including rarity, condition, provenance, and the popularity of the player or event associated with the item. Understanding these factors can help you make informed purchasing decisions and potentially identify undervalued items.

  • Rarity: Limited edition items, one-of-a-kind pieces, and items associated with rare events command higher prices.
  • Condition: Items in excellent condition, with minimal wear and tear, are generally worth more than those in poor condition.
  • Provenance: A well-documented history of ownership can significantly increase an item’s value, especially if it can be traced back to the player or event in question.
  • Player Popularity: Items associated with popular and successful players are typically more valuable than those associated with lesser-known players.
  • Tournament Significance: Memorabilia from major tournaments, such as the World Championship, is highly sought after.

Caring for Your Collection: Preservation Tips

Once you’ve acquired your precious BDO PDC Memorabilia, it’s essential to take proper care of it to maintain its value and preserve it for future generations. Here are some practical preservation tips:

  • Proper Storage: Store items in a cool, dry place away from direct sunlight and extreme temperatures. Use archival-quality storage materials to prevent damage from acids and other contaminants.
  • Handling with Care: Handle items with clean hands or wear gloves to avoid transferring oils and dirt.
  • Framing and Display: Use acid-free mats and UV-protective glass when framing photographs, tickets, or other paper items. Ensure that display cases are properly sealed to prevent dust and moisture from entering.
  • Regular Cleaning: Gently clean items with a soft, dry cloth to remove dust and debris. Avoid using harsh chemicals or abrasive cleaners.
  • Insurance: Consider insuring your collection against loss or damage. Appraise your collection regularly to ensure that your insurance coverage is adequate.

Documenting Your Collection: Creating an Inventory

Maintaining a detailed inventory of your BDO PDC Memorabilia is crucial for insurance purposes, estate planning, and simply keeping track of your collection. Include the following information for each item:

  • Description: A detailed description of the item, including its type, size, materials, and any unique features.
  • Acquisition Date: The date you acquired the item.
  • Acquisition Cost: The price you paid for the item.
  • Provenance: Information about the item’s history, including where it came from and who owned it previously.
  • Certificate of Authenticity: If applicable, include a copy of the certificate of authenticity.
  • Photographs: Take clear photographs of the item from multiple angles.
